The Hengst 20.660 PWR10-S00-6-M (1011889B) is a hydraulic filter element designed for efficient filtration in hydraulic systems. It plays a crucial role in maintaining system cleanliness by capturing contaminants and ensuring optimal fluid purity. The filter element features a multilayer glass fiber material, designated as PWR, which provides excellent dirt holding capacity and retention capabilities. With dimensions of 333 mm in length, 142.5 mm outer diameter, and 95 mm inner diameter, this filter element is engineered to fit specific hydraulic applications requiring precise filtration performance. It includes a bypass valve coded at 6 and has a collapse pressure rating classified as standard, ensuring reliable operation under varying pressure conditions. The seal is made from NBR material, indicated by the seal code M, offering robust sealing capabilities to prevent leakage. The design class of this product is categorized as a filter element with support cage material marked as standard. The Hengst 20 series filter element has a nominal size of 660 and does not include suitability for HFC or HFA fluids nor adheres to DIN24550 standards. It also does not feature an additional support cage but maintains structural integrity through its robust construction. The Filter Element is the central component in a filter, where the actual filtration takes place. The key filter parameters such as retention capacity, dirt holding capacity and pressure loss are determined by the Filter Element and the filter media used.
